Pentwater PD hosts dive training. #PentaterPoliceDepartment PENTWATER — Divers from Midland, Newaygo, Ottawa, Wayne and Oceana counties joined forces in Pentwater last weekend to participate in “Dive Rescue One” training. The three-day course combined classroom study with field exercises to provide students both instruction on the current best practices and an opportunity to demonstrate the skills they learned. Boat valued at $14,000 stolen. #OceanaCountyCrime COLFAX TOWNSHIP — A 2001 24-foot Sylvan pontoon boat valued at $14,000 was stolen from School Section Lake near Walkerville, according to Oceana County Sheriff Craig Mast. The boat was on a trailer valued at $700, and the trailer was also stolen. The boat has a blue cover and an outboard 54-horsepower Mercury motor.…
